RECRUITMENT AND SELECTION SUPERVISOR

PLASP Child Care Services is a charitable organization operating on a not-for-profit basis, providing high quality early learning and child care, for children up to 12 years of age. PLASP operates programs in more than 240 schools providing before and after school care. PLASP also operates 31 full-day early learning and child care centres and 6 EarlyON locations for children from 0 – 6 years.

PLASP is committed to hiring, training, and fairly compensating staff. All Ontarians have the right to equal treatment with respect to employment without discrimination or harassment. We believe that everyone has worth and value, and that all staff are entitled to be respected, supported, and treated fairly by their co-workers and supervisors.

Reporting to the Human Resources Manager of Operations, the Recruitment and Selection Supervisor will provide leadership, direction and supervision to the Recruitment and Onboarding team to assist with the management of all PLASP internal and external recruitment. 

 

THE POSITION INVOLVES…

The successful candidate will provide a full range of duties, including:

  • Provide leadership, direction, and support to the Recruitment and Selection and Onboarding team
  • Receive and reviews all Head Office Recruitment request and reviews/ seeks approval with HR Management team
  • Works with recruitment team on development of job postings and recruitment timelines for postings
  • Works closely with recruitment team on all recruitment documents; including interview guidelines, materials and employment condition documents
  • Conducts full recruitment process for complex PLASP positions
  • Seeks out career fairs and marketing of employment opportunities for PLASP
  • Conducts detailed data analysis on recruitment and onboarding reporting and statistic
  • Ensure continuous hiring strategies are in place to meet the recruitment demands of the organization

 

 

THE PREFERRED CANDIDATE WILL HAVE…

  • Successful completion of Human Resources Management Post Graduate diploma
  • CHRL Designation an assets
  • 5 years of complete recruitment and selection cycle management
  • Minimum of 3 Years of supervisory experience of a team
  • Strong knowledge of Recruitment and Selection and HR best practices
  • Excellent oral and written communication skills and interpersonal skills      
  • Strong problem solving and analytical skills
  • Demonstrated knowledge and usage of an Applicant Tracking System
  • Strong computer skills, applications and database management    
  • Awareness of the need for and respect of confidentiality
  • Self-motivated, flexible and able to accept increased responsibility with minimal supervision
